Father and son have life-threatening injuries after Clay County ATV accident

CLAY COUNTY, Fla. — The Florida Highway Patrol is investigating after a Green Cove Springs father and son riding an ATV got into a crash with a teen driving a pickup truck.

The crash happened just before 9 p.m. Tuesday night on Russell Road near Watkins Road in Green Cove Springs.

Thomas Clark, 51, was driving the ATV with his 17-year-old son Kameron riding on the back. FHP said the father and son were involved in a previous crash before they were hit.

Troopers say Kameron is in critical condition while the injuries to his father are considered serious. Both were taken to UF Health Jacksonville.

FHP is still investigating to find out how 18-year-old driver Jeremy Truesdell didn't see them stopped in the road until it was too late.

Thomas and Kameron Clark were thrown from the ATV, which flipped over and came to rest on the shoulder. Neither were wearing helmets.
